Pennsylvania has achieved a remarkable milestone by ranking among the top three states in the U.S. for artificial intelligence (AI) adoption within state government, according to a recent assessment by the civic tech nonprofit Code for America. This recognition is based on various criteria including Leadership and Governance, AI Capacity Building, and Technical Infrastructure & Capabilities.

In this assessment, Pennsylvania, alongside New Jersey and Utah, received an advanced rating for its AI readiness. The evaluation pointed out the state’s comprehensive policies, ethical frameworks, capacity building initiatives, and effective pilot programs as pivotal factors that contributed to its top-tier status in AI implementation.

In 2023, Governor Josh Shapiro took significant steps to enhance this framework by signing an executive order that established the Generative AI Governing Board. This board is tasked with overseeing AI policies within the administration. A strategic partnership with Carnegie Mellon University and InnovateUS has been instrumental in training state employees in the utilization of AI tools, further boosting Pennsylvania’s AI readiness.

The existing IT infrastructure within the state has also played a crucial role in supporting the effective deployment of AI technologies. The Shapiro administration recently initiated a pilot program with just under 200 employees deployed to utilize ChatGPT Enterprise, a leading AI tool. Exit surveys conducted after the pilot revealed that employees saved approximately 95 minutes each day on average, which has significantly enhanced their productivity.

Governor Shapiro has underscored the perspective that AI serves as a job enhancer rather than a replacer, emphasizing its importance in modern governance. The pilot program is expected to expand after May 31, 2025, thereby increasing the number of employees who will benefit from generative AI tools and applications.

During the pilot, participating employees found various uses for ChatGPT, including writing assistance, text generation, and research tasks. An impressive 85% of participants reported a positive experience with the AI technology, with many indicating that they had never used ChatGPT prior to the pilot program. Feedback from these employees will be vital for shaping the future AI initiatives in the Shapiro administration.

Despite these advancements, concerns have been raised regarding worker privacy and job security, particularly from union representatives. In response to these concerns, the administration has committed to involving union-covered employees in future AI projects, thus ensuring a collaborative approach as AI technologies continue to evolve within government operations.

This pilot program is part of Governor Shapiro’s broader vision to leverage AI technologies to improve government efficiency and service delivery. By prioritizing employee training and addressing ethical considerations in AI deployment, Pennsylvania is positioning itself as a leader in state-level technology adoption, ultimately aiming to set a benchmark for AI integration within public service.

The successful implementation of AI technologies in Pennsylvania illustrates a significant shift toward innovation in government practices, making the state a noteworthy example for others to follow as they consider the potential benefits that AI can bring to public administration.
